HackSat One is due to launch on 9th December 2013. This page summarises areas we need to work on for Hackney Space Centre prior to launch.
Mast & Antenna
- Making mast trailer operational
- Steerable antenna
- Control software for antenna
- Test with ISS and FUNcube
Signal Decoding
- GNU Radio automation
- Borg and sister servers
- Increasing speed of FFT (GPU? AVX?)
Mission Control
- Tracking ISS and HackSat Orbit
- Communications with other ground stations and main KickSat mission control
- Visualising decoded data from our and other ground stations, e.g. spinning 3D model of sprite matching actual motion of HackSat
- Physically building out area in Hackspace with monitors, comms etc.
- Where does this go physically in the Space?
Science!
- What can we learn from the data?
- Sensors: temperature, magnetic field, gyroscope (spin rate), uptime (solar power available)
